Germany. Kienast-576. The German-French Armistice. Medal Hubs and Dies: By Karl Goetz. 36 mm obverse and reverse Hubs. 36 mm (2) obverse and reverse Dies. On June 22, 1940 (the medal shows erroneously a June 21 date) an Armistice was concluded by France with Germany at Compiegne in the railway carriage where Marchal Foch had dictated terms to the German delegation on November 11, 1918.
